Output 27caa4a2187498773f6814df2f00e0af3ce904e06cd28a0924a9f950882f6f83:0

value
6950846409420
script pubkey
OP_0 OP_PUSHBYTES_20 500f6bd87a4482e797826911cc7fbd8a1ffbda4d
address
tb1q2q8khkr6gjpw09uzdyguclaa3g0lhkjduuszr2
transaction
27caa4a2187498773f6814df2f00e0af3ce904e06cd28a0924a9f950882f6f83
confirmations
176002
spent
true